Summary
Peter Gabriel has released "A Hard Lesson," the latest song from his ongoing o/i project that drops a new track every full moon. The song is the oldest in the project, originating in the late '80s or early '90s during a trip to Senegal, and Gabriel has been refining the self-described "quirky" track for decades. The song was produced by Gabriel and Mike Elizondo.
